This pick is being made for New Orleans, so Pondexter is headed to the Hornets as part of the big deal made earlier in the evening.
As a senior, Pondexter, a 6-6, 225-pound swingman, averaged 19.3 points, so he’s a proven scorer. But it’s another roster that’s in the process of getting shaken up. But he could, with an impressive summer and training camp, take some of the minutes vacated by Morris Peterson, who was dealt to Oklahoma City.
